AGI in Healthcare: The Current Landscape

The use of AGI in healthcare is still in its early stages, but the potential benefits are already being realized. AGI algorithms are being used to analyze medical images, such as X-rays, CT scans, and MRIs, to help radiologists detect and diagnose diseases more accurately and quickly. These algorithms can also predict patient outcomes and help healthcare providers make more informed treatment decisions.

In addition to image analysis, AGI is also being used to improve patient care in other ways. For example, AGI-powered virtual assistants are being developed to help patients manage their chronic conditions, such as diabetes and hypertension, by providing personalized treatment plans and reminders. These virtual assistants can also connect patients with healthcare providers in real-time, allowing for more timely and effective care.

The use of AGI in healthcare is not without its challenges, however. Privacy and security concerns are top of mind for many patients and healthcare providers, as AGI algorithms require access to sensitive patient data in order to function effectively. Additionally, there is a fear that AGI could replace human healthcare providers, leading to a loss of jobs and a decrease in the quality of care. Despite these challenges, the potential benefits of AGI in healthcare are too great to ignore.

Benefits of AGI in Healthcare

There are numerous benefits to integrating AGI into healthcare, including:

1. Improved Diagnosis Accuracy: AGI algorithms can analyze medical images and other data more quickly and accurately than humans, leading to more timely and accurate diagnoses.

2. Personalized Treatment Plans: AGI algorithms can analyze patient data to create personalized treatment plans that are tailored to each individual’s unique needs and preferences.

3. Predictive Analytics: AGI algorithms can predict patient outcomes based on historical data, allowing healthcare providers to intervene earlier and prevent adverse events.

4. Increased Efficiency: AGI can automate routine tasks, such as scheduling appointments and processing paperwork, allowing healthcare providers to focus more time and energy on patient care.

5. Enhanced Patient Experience: AGI-powered virtual assistants can provide patients with round-the-clock support and guidance, improving overall patient satisfaction.

Q: Will AGI replace human healthcare providers?

A: While AGI has the potential to automate certain tasks in healthcare, such as image analysis and administrative work, it is unlikely to replace human healthcare providers entirely. AGI is best used as a tool to support and enhance the work of healthcare providers, rather than replace them.

Q: How will patient data be protected when using AGI in healthcare?

A: Privacy and security concerns are top of mind when using AGI in healthcare. Healthcare providers must comply with strict regulations, such as HIPAA, to ensure that patient data is protected and secure. AGI algorithms should also be designed with privacy and security in mind, with robust encryption and access controls in place.

Q: How can healthcare providers prepare for the integration of AGI?

A: Healthcare providers can prepare for the integration of AGI by investing in training and education for their staff, updating their IT infrastructure to support AGI algorithms, and collaborating with AGI developers and researchers to ensure the successful implementation of AGI in healthcare.
